My daughter got bitten at daycare a few months ago by a slightly older child. These things happen when kids are young. And I know from experience that kids can do things so fast that it's not always possible to catch them in the act. I don't think the caregivers were negligent. I'll feel bad if my child becomes a biter (she's been slow to teethe), and will do whatever I can to nip it in the bud (pun?) but I didn't hold it against the kid who bit her. They were just playing. It didn't scar or bother her afterward.

Try not to worry about it unless it happens again while your child is still really young; then, i think it would be natural to wonder if the older kids were being adequately supervised around the younger ones.
